Designing Productive and Engaging Remote Workspaces
Remote work has revolutionized the approach we think about work, presenting unprecedented freedom. However, creating a productive and engaging remote workspace requires deliberate design.
A well-designed remote workspace can improve productivity, promote collaboration, and cultivate a feeling of connection.
Here are some key elements to consider:
* **Ergonomics:** Invest in ergonomic furniture to minimize physical strain and promote health.
* **Technology:** Guarantee reliable and fast internet access for seamless collaboration.
* **Dedicated Workspace:** Create a defined workspace that indicates the transition from work to personal time.
* **Lighting and Greenery:** Natural lighting and live plants can improve mood and focus.
* **Communication and Collaboration:** Utilize platforms that support effective communication and collaboration among team members.

Mastering the Challenges of Remote Workspaces
Remote work has become increasingly prevalent, offering flexibility and autonomy. However, it also presents unique obstacles. One key factor is maintaining interaction with colleagues. Virtual meetings can sometimes lack the spontaneity of in-person interactions, making it crucial to cultivate remote workspaces clear lines of communication. Furthermore, separating work life from personal life can be difficult when your office is in your home. Setting guidelines and creating a dedicated workspace are essential for effectiveness. Additionally, remote workers may experience feelings of loneliness. It's important to intentionally engage with colleagues and participate in virtual social activities to combat this.
